The word for today is -Boldly !
 
The blood of Jesus, who through the Spirit offered himself unblemished to God, cleanse our consciences from acts that lead to death, so that we may serve the living God.  For this reason Jesus is the mediator of a new covenant, that those who are called may receive the promised eternal inheritance, now that he has died as a ransom to set us free from the sins committed under the first covenant, now we can enter in boldly to the throne of grace. Read Hebrews 4:16, Let us therefore come boldly unto the throne of grace, that we may obtain mercy, and find grace to help in time of need. He made a way for us to enter in, we have access to God. Thank you Jesus! The law requires that nearly everything be cleansed with blood, and without the shedding of blood there is no forgiveness. Now, let's read Ephesians 3:12, “In whom we have boldness and access with confidence by the faith of him”.This verse is speaking of coming to God boldly. We simply cannot measure the reliability of God’s Word by examining our situation or our worthiness. If we do, we’ll end up only seeing that we’re unworthy. And we’ll talk ourselves out of claiming his Word. Now, He gives us all an invitation, read Hebrews 10:19-23, Having therefore brethren, boldness to enter into the holiest by the blood of Jesus, By a new and living way which he consecrated for us, through the veil, that is to say, his flesh: And having a high priest over the house of God; Let us draw near with a true heart in full assurance of faith, having our hearts sprinkled from an evil conscience and our bodies washed with pure water. Let us hold fast the profession of our faith  without wavering;( for he is faithful that promised;) Thank you God for your word. Amen !
